Francis Billington 1606 – 1684 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: abt 1606

Birth Location: Lincolnshire, England

Death Date: 3 Dec 1684

Death Location: Middleborough, Plymouth, Massachusetts

Father: John Billington

Mother: Eleanor Lockwood

Spouse(s): Christian Penn

Children(s): Rachel Billington, Samuel Eaton, Elizabeth Billington, Joseph Billington, Martha Billington, Mary Billington, Isaac Billington, Rebecca Billington, Dorcas Billington, Mercy Billington

The story of Francis Billington began in 1606 in Lincolnshire, England. Francis Billington married Christian Penn, and had children including Rachel Billington, Samuel Eaton, Elizabeth Billington, Joseph Billington, Martha Billington, Mary Billington, Isaac Billington, Rebecca Billington, Dorcas Billington, Mercy Billington. Francis Billington passed away in 1684 in Middleborough, Plymouth, Massachusetts.
